Victor Osimhen provided two goals on Friday, including a dramatic late winner in a 3-2 home victory against Samsunspor in the Turkish Super Lig.

The Nigerian, making his second consecutive start for the Super Lig leaders and reigning champions, scored his first goal since suffering an injury on international duty to double the lead for the hosts in the 29th minute. Receiving a pass from Leroy Sane, the striker slipped his finish past onrushing Samsunspor goalkeeper Okan Kocuk. Sane opened the scoring inside the opening ten minutes.
The visitors did bounce back despite an 0-2 halftime deficit. Anthony Musaba pulled a goal back in the 56th minute as Samsunspor looked more dangerous in the second half. Late on, the Super Lig’s surprise package this season nearly completed another shock result when Emre Kilinc equalized in the 88th minute.
However, Osimhen produced a moment of magic to spare his club’s blushes in stoppage time. A cross from the right wing was nodded towards the six-yard box where the former Napoli star produced an acrobatic bicycle kick finish to snatch maximum points in dramatic fashion.
After being forced off at halftime of Nigeria’s decisive 2026 World Cup qualifying playoff defeat to DR Congo due to a hamstring injury, Osimhen missed a couple of matches before returning for a 1-1 draw with Fenerbahce in an Istanbul derby. After failing to find the net against Fener, the Super Eagles star now has 11 goals in 14 appearances across all competitions this season following Friday’s brace.
The league leaders are now four points clear of Fenerbahce with one more match played in what appears to be an intriguing title chase in the Turkish top flight.
Next up is a return to UEFA Champions League action away at Monaco on Tuesday. Osimhen is currently second on the scoring charts in Europe’s top club competition with 6 goals in 3 matches.
